Spain is inviting Sephardic Jews from anywhere in the world to reclaim citizenship, an interesting mea culpa for the Inquisition. Jews were obviously persecuted, killed, and/or driven out of the country at that time, and there are relatively few left, mostly in places like Turkey; many are now Catholic because the families converted. But the descendants will all be eligible.
